What does Backhousia Citriodor do in a cosmetic formula?

This ingredient is primarily used as a botanical fragrance component, with fresh citrus aromatic character. Depending on the extract type, it may also contribute mild deodorizing or antimicrobial-supporting effects in a formula.

Is Backhousia Citriodor clean?

From a clean beauty perspective, it is generally acceptable when naturally derived, but it carries fragrance-allergen considerations because it can contain high levels of citral-related constituents. It is best assessed by total fragrance load, allergen disclosure, and sensitization testing rather than by source alone.

Is Backhousia Citriodor sustainable?

This material is plant-derived and typically sourced from leaves, often through steam distillation or botanical extraction. It is expected to be biodegradable, with sustainability quality depending on cultivation practices, water use, and traceable agricultural supply.

Is Backhousia Citriodor COSMOS-approved?

It can be permitted under COSMOS-natural and COSMOS-organic when produced through approved physical or green extraction methods and supported by the required natural-origin documentation. Its Green Chemistry fit is strongest when it comes from renewable plant material and low-solvent processing, with the main caveat being fragrance sensitization management.

How does Backhousia Citriodor work chemically?

Chemically, this is a complex botanical aromatic material, often rich in aldehydic citrus-smelling constituents such as geranial and neral. It is usually used at low fragrance-range levels, and the aldehydic fraction can oxidize with air, heat, and light, so antioxidants, tight packaging, and controlled storage are common co-formulation considerations.
